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$745 in Maracaibo versus $713 in Acarigua.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,249 in Maracaibo versus $1,229 in Acarigua.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,753 in Maracaibo versus $1,744 in Acarigua.

Living in Maracaibo is roughly 4% more expensive than in Acarigua,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ities sit below the global median: Maracaibo 44% lower, Acarigua 47% lower.
